The Puerta del Puente is one of the gates of the Roman wall that protected Córdoba. Although its appearance has been completely renovated throughout history, its location at the north end of the Roman Bridge has remained intact.

The Alcázar de los Reyes Cristianos, fortress and palace with solid walls, encloses in its interior a large part of the architectural evolution of Córdoba.
